One of those should work fine as long as the bike doesn't weigh more than the limited tounge weight of your receiver. A ninja 250 is very light and shouldn't be a problem.funsocaltiger wrote:I'm new here so I apologize if this is in the wrong forum, but I couldn't really figure out if any of the others would be more appropriate.
